Steerage Passage Ticket of Wycherley Family

This ticket was issued to twelve members of the Wycherley family for travel from London to Auckland, aboard the Jessie Readman, departing 5 August 1885. The ticket details the quantities of water that will be issued daily to each adult passenger, together with the weekly allowance of foodstuffs.
By 1892 the Wycherley family were living in Ashhurst. The family later established the business C W Wycherley and Son, Saddlers and Harness Makers in The Square, Palmerston North (c.1899-1919).
This image is derived from a copy negative made from a document loaned for copying. The original ticket is not held by the Ian Matheson City Archives.
